The defense team representing former President Hashim Thaçi has formally submitted a request for his conditional release from the Special Court in The Hague. This submission was acknowledged by the Special Court, which is now considering the terms outlined by the defense. As part of the request, the defense has offered a financial guarantee totaling 50,000 euros, intended to secure the former president’s release.
According to the defense’s filing, the primary basis for this appeal is the assertion that Mr. Thaçi does not present any risk of absconding or fleeing the jurisdiction. The defense team has stipulated several strict conditions under which the former president is willing to comply with a conditional release.
Beyond the financial surety, the conditions mandate that Thaçi must not leave the territory of Kosovo. Furthermore, he must surrender his passport and all other forms of travel documentation to the Court’s authorities. A crucial element of the proposed arrangement also requires that the former president refrain from making any public statements regarding the proceedings.
This request initiates a procedural review by the Special Court to assess the adequacy of the guarantees and the feasibility of the proposed restrictions. The Court must now weigh the terms presented against its mandate to ensure the integrity of the ongoing judicial process while considering the defense’s assurances regarding accountability and compliance.
